Provenance

Where it came from

Phyrexian Arena was originally released in the 2000 Apocalypse set, designed by Wizards of the Coast to be a powerful, recurring card-draw engine for black decks. The card captures the dark, biomechanical aesthetic of the Phyrexians, a central antagonistic force in the Magic: The Gathering multiverse. It remains a staple in casual and competitive formats due to its efficient cost and the thematic trade-off of sacrificing life for cards.

This specific iteration, featured in the 2021 Commander Collection: Black, showcases new artwork by Vincent Proce. Proce reimagined the iconic arena with a focus on visceral, industrial horror, leaning into the updated lore of the New Phyrexian aesthetic. The set was curated as a tribute to black-aligned cards that are essential to the Commander format, intended to provide players with stylized, cohesive versions of historically significant enchantments and spells.
